Subject: Inkwell markdown pipeline 5.1 deployed

On-call: the Inkwell rendering pipeline is now on 5.1 in production. Changes: sanitizer runs before the table parser, footnote rendering is cached per document, and the fallback plain-text path no longer strips headings. If render latency alarms fire, roll back via the standard script — it handles cache invalidation. Known issue: nested blockquotes over six levels render flat. The deployment trace token follows.

build token for hawep-kageg: htk14_558814e2114cc7

Handover note — cold storage archiving, from the Tidemark infra rotation. Welcome aboard. The monthly job moves buckets older than 180 days into the Glacierline archive tier. Check the manifest in the archiver repo first; never archive buckets flagged "legal-hold." The archiver's service credentials expire quarterly, and if the renewal fails the account locks. Recovery is self-serve through the Tidemark console but prompts for our shared passphrase, which is recorded just below this note.

unlock words, yahof-tafog: norius-lamael-rusir-sordor

## Step 3: Migrate the schedule store

Stop the Sproutly scheduler daemon. Run `sproutly-migrate v4` to move watering intervals into the new `plans` table. Do not restart until the migration reports zero pending rows. Verify with `sproutly-migrate --check`. Rollback is only supported before the first watering job fires. Apply the migration against the target database using the connection string below.

warehouse DSN: mysql://istius_svc:FI1JCO3@db-de6a.paliqdyn.internal:5432/istiel

## Digest Scheduler — Quick Reference

Mailloom batches user notifications into hourly and daily digests. Scheduler runs on the cron-runner pool in Ostfold. If digests stall, check queue depth first; over 50k pending means the window overlapped the previous run. Do not manually trigger a second run — it double-sends. Restart the scheduler pod only after the lock expires (max 10 min). Verify the active window settings against what follows below.

settings of tagef-bawif:
DRUIX_HOST=druix.zemvarlabs.internal
DRUIX_PORT=8000